Edit a category to search:
select other


Contractors & Construction in Shobonier, IL

Horst Quality Builders
823 N 1300 StShobonier, IL, 62885
6188462034
Building ContractorsConstruction CompaniesReal Estate CompaniesReal Estate DevelopersRemodeling Contractors